Enhancing HIV-1 Latency Reversal through Regulating the Elongating RNA Pol II Pause-Release by a Small-Molecule Disruptor of PAF1C
A small-molecule inhibitor of PAF1C enhanced the activity of diverse HIV-1 latency reversal agents both in cell line latency models and in primary cells from persons living with HIV-1.
[Journal Of Clinical Investigation] Researchers showed that RB1-loss/E2F activation sensitized cancer cells to ferroptosis, a form of regulated cell death driven by iron-dependent lipid peroxidation, by upregulating expression of ACSL4 and enriching ACSL4-dependent arachidonic acid-containing phospholipids, which are key components of ferroptosis execution.
